The Ski Classics Challengers event, Granfondo Dobbiaco/Toblach – Cortina Classic, took place this Saturday with a 31km long-distance skiing race in classic technique in Toblach, Italy. Check out the results.

After a day full of action, the Ski Classics Challengers event in Italy, the Granfondo Dobbiaco/Toblach – Cortina Classic, saw a fierce battle for all the podium places. Ultimately, Andreas Nygaard, Team Ragde Charge, and Malin Börjesjö, Team Internorm Trentino GSG, won their respective races with solid performances.

Men’s Race

In the men’s event, the winner, Andreas Nygaard, Team Ragde Charge, completed the race in a time of 1:33:04.8.

Francesco Ferrari, Team Internorm Trentino GSG, finished in second place, 0.4 seconds behind, followed by Lauri Lepisto, Team Electrofit, completing the podium in third position and 0.5 seconds back.

Women’s Race 

In the women’s competition, the winner was Malin Börjesjö, Team Internorm Trentino GSG, completing the event in a total time of 1:36:06.7.

Oda Nerdrum, Team Robinson Trentino, finished in second place, 1:10.7 back, followed by Heli Heiskanen, Team Internorm Trentino GSG, 1:14.2 behind the winner, and completing the podium in third place.

As the Granfondo Dobbiaco/Toblach-Cortina 31km Classic is a Ski Classics Challengers event, Pro Team registered athletes could collect points for the Ski Classics Champion and Youth competitions in their respective genders.
